Abstract
G. Mackey introduced the notion of smooth equivalence relation in the context of unitary group representations. Over the last two decades Mackey's notion was extended to an abstract framework for analyzing classification problems in mathematics. Methods developed by Hjorth, Kechris and others enable one to precisely define when one classification problem is more difficult than another. Classification problems are compared using the relation of Borel-reducibility. I will outline some of the recent results, putting a particular emphasis on applications to Elliott's program for classification of nuclear C*-algebras. This is a joint work with a number of coauthors.
